The loos gauge is designed to be a simple and easy-to-use tool that provides a clear pass/fail result It consists of a precision ground gauge that is made to the exact dimensions of the part being inspected The go side of the gauge is designed to fit into the part with the maximum allowable tolerance, while the no-go side is slightly larger to verify that the part does not exceed the maximum tolerance If the go side fits but the no-go side does not, the part is within tolerance If the no-go side fits, the part is out of tolerance and must be rejected.
